Detox IV Therapy Myths and Facts You Should Know
Detox IV therapy sits at the crossroads of medical IV practice and wellness culture. On one side, you have intravenous therapy, a clinical tool that moves fluids, electrolytes, vitamins, and certain medications directly into the bloodstream. On the other, a consumer market promising faster recovery, clearer skin, more energy, and even “removal of toxins.” The truth lives between those poles. I have seen IV treatment help dehydrated athletes bounce back after a brutal weekend, and I have watched it disappoint people who expected it to erase months of poor sleep and a sugar-loaded diet. Sorting myth from fact matters because the line between helpful and wasteful, or safe and risky, depends on understanding what these drips can and cannot do.
What “detox” means in medicine versus marketing
Clinically, detoxification refers to the liver, kidneys, lungs, gastrointestinal tract, skin, and lymphatic system processing and excreting byproducts of metabolism and external exposures. These organs run nonstop. They use enzymes, transporters, and antioxidants to transform fat-soluble compounds into water-soluble ones, so you can exhale, sweat, urinate, or defecate them out. That machinery is astonishingly efficient in a healthy person.
In the wellness space, detox often gets used as shorthand for feeling “reset.” After travel, a heavy night out, or the tail end of a respiratory bug, people want a faster route back to normal. IV infusion therapy appeals because it bypasses the gut, which can be finicky during nausea or illness, and it delivers known quantities quickly. Both frameworks can coexist, as long as claims about toxins are kept honest. IV drip therapy does not scour plaque from arteries or purge environmental chemicals lodged in fat tissue. It can, however, correct dehydration, replenish electrolytes and vitamins, and support physiological pathways your body already uses to clear waste.
The core of detox IV therapy: what’s in the bag
Most detox IV therapy formulas are variations on a theme: saline or balanced crystalloids for volume, electrolytes like sodium, potassium, and magnesium, B complex and vitamin C for metabolic support, and sometimes antioxidants such as glutathione. You’ll also see add-ons aimed at symptoms, for example anti-nausea medications during hangover IV therapy, or magnesium in migraine IV therapy.
Hydration IV therapy works because fluids restore plasma volume, which improves kidney perfusion and supports the blood pressure needed to deliver oxygen and nutrients. Vitamin IV therapy can raise serum levels more rapidly than oral dosing, especially when the gut is irritated or when higher transient levels are desired. Some clinics deploy a Myers cocktail IV, a longstanding mix that commonly includes magnesium, calcium, B complex, and vitamin C. I have used variations of Myers IV therapy in patients who struggle with oral intake or need a same day IV therapy boost after gastrointestinal illness.
If you see claims about exotic compounds, ask for the exact ingredients, doses, and rationale. A detox drip should not be a mystery.
Myth 1: Detox IV therapy removes toxins directly from your blood
This is the most persistent myth. No standard IV wellness therapy acts like a dialysis machine. Dialysis physically clears solutes through a membrane with pressure gradients, performed by specialists with sterile circuits and precise monitoring. A vitamin drip therapy does not filter your blood. What an IV can do is provide the tools and conditions your body uses to process compounds. Fluids support kidney filtration. Vitamin C and B vitamins participate in metabolic reactions. Glutathione, produced in your cells, plays a role in redox balance and hepatic conjugation.
So the accurate framing looks like this: IV nutrient therapy can support detoxification pathways, mainly by correcting deficits and enhancing hydration. It cannot cleanse your blood of specific toxins on demand. If a clinic promises to “flush heavy metals” with a basic hydration drip, that is marketing, not medicine. Chelation therapy for heavy metal poisoning exists, but it is a separate, tightly controlled medical treatment with its own risks.
Myth 2: Any IV is safer and more effective than oral supplements
Intravenous routes are powerful and fast. They are not inherently safer. With IV vitamin therapy you skip the regulatory step of your gut and liver that typically blunts spikes in nutrient levels. That is the advantage for someone who cannot tolerate oral supplements or needs a medical IV therapy for a clear indication. It is also the risk, because supraphysiologic levels can have side effects, and sterility matters.
Vitamin C IV therapy, for example, can be helpful in selected contexts. People with glucose-6-phosphate dehydrogenase deficiency risk hemolysis if exposed to high dose vitamin C IV. Those with a history of kidney stones or renal impairment should approach cautiously, especially at doses above a few grams, because oxalate can increase. Magnesium IV therapy can calm muscle cramps and migraines, but too much magnesium can lower blood pressure and cause flushing or dizziness. Zinc IV therapy is uncommon due to irritation; oral zinc is more typical for routine immune support.
In short, IV infusion therapy can be more effective than oral routes for specific goals, like rapid rehydration or bypassing gastrointestinal upset. But it carries procedure risks that a multivitamin does not, and the “more is better” instinct can backfire if dosing is not thoughtful.
Myth 3: A detox drip cancels out alcohol, poor sleep, or a high-sodium binge
Hangover IV therapy is popular for a reason. Hydration, electrolytes, B vitamins, and anti-nausea or anti-inflammatory medications can ease the hangover slog. I have watched a hungover patient go from gray and sweaty to conversational within an hour after an IV rehydration therapy and ondansetron. That does not mean the IV erases the biological impact of alcohol or resets your liver. Alcohol dehydrogenase and aldehyde dehydrogenase still do the work, and acetaldehyde is not cleared faster just because you received saline.
The same applies to a weekend of poor sleep or junk food. An energy drip can lift perceived energy for a day or two because fluids improve circulation and B vitamins support mitochondrial processes. But IV energy boost sessions cannot replace deep sleep, regular meals, or training. Think of them as a crutch for acute dips, not a foundation for health. The durable benefits of wellness IV therapy show up when it complements smarter habits.
Myth 4: Every detox IV therapy is the same
IV therapy services vary widely. Some clinics stick to evidence-informed mixes with clear dosing. Others add trendy ingredients without strong rationale. The difference matters. For example:
A basic hydration drip uses normal saline or a balanced solution like lactated Ringer’s. This is ideal for dehydration IV therapy after travel, heat exposure, or a gastrointestinal illness that left you depleted. A vitamin infusion therapy adds B complex and vitamin C, sometimes minerals. It suits someone who needs a general boost but has limited oral intake. An antioxidant IV therapy might include a glutathione IV drip at the end of the session. Glutathione is naturally produced in cells and is central to redox balance. Some patients report a mild skin glow after a series, which fits the “beauty IV therapy” narrative, although research is mixed on systemic cosmetic effects. Athletic recovery IV therapy or sports IV therapy tends to layer fluids, electrolytes, magnesium, and amino acids. I find it useful for tournament weekends or after marathons, especially when stomach upset limits drinking and eating. Migraine IV therapy often relies on magnesium, fluids, antiemetics, and sometimes anti-inflammatory medication or an antihistamine. It is different from a general detox drip because the goal is symptom relief and neuromuscular relaxation, not “cleansing.”
Customization should have a reason. Personalized IV therapy is only valuable if the ingredients and doses match your history, labs, and goals.
Where IV therapy shows clear utility
The clearest wins occur in three scenarios: dehydration, nutrient repletion when the gut is unreliable, and specific therapeutic protocols.
IV hydration therapy is fast and predictable. After a bout of food poisoning or a long hike in desert heat, getting one liter of intravenous fluids therapy can reverse tachycardia and dizziness within minutes. Patients with chronic gastrointestinal disease sometimes use IV nutrient therapy during flares to bridge intake gaps. Therapeutic IV infusion plays a role in medical settings for migraines, severe nausea, and certain pain flares, using medications and minerals with proven effect.
For general wellness, the benefit band is narrower but real. People juggling red-eye flights, conference schedules, and missed meals often feel better after a recovery drip. The improvement is not mystical. We are topping off fluid compartments, easing mild deficiencies, and nudging the autonomic nervous system away from the wired-tired state. I counsel clients that they will notice better sleep the night after, a steadier mood, and a higher ceiling for exercise the next day, provided they follow the session with water, protein, and rest.
Evidence check: what research can and cannot tell you
Research on preventive IV therapy outside of disease states is limited. We have strong data on IV fluids for dehydration, and good evidence for specific IV medications in emergency care. For vitamin IV therapy in healthy or mildly unwell adults, the literature is mostly small trials, case series, and extrapolations from pharmacokinetics. That does not make all wellness IV therapy useless, but it does demand intellectual honesty.

Vitamin C IV therapy has been studied at high doses as an adjunct in oncology and sepsis, with mixed results and ongoing debate. Those contexts do not map cleanly to routine immunity IV therapy. There is plausible mechanistic support for B complex IV therapy in people under heavy stress or with limited intake, and magnesium IV therapy in migraines has support in multiple trials. Glutathione IV therapy has pharmacologic rationale, yet systematic reviews call for more rigorous outcome data in non-disease populations.
What I tell clients: use outcomes you can measure. If your primary complaints are fatigue, sleep fragmentation, and frequent colds, track days of productivity, sleep duration and latency, and infection frequency over two to three months. If IV wellness therapy moves those numbers meaningfully while you maintain core habits, it is earning its keep. If not, we adjust or stop.
Safety, screening, and setting matter more than the menu
Minor risks include bruising, infiltration, and temporary dizziness. Less common but serious complications include infection, phlebitis, allergic reactions, fluid overload in susceptible individuals, and electrolyte disturbances from overly aggressive formulas. Sterile technique is non-negotiable. So is proper intake screening.
Before any IV treatment, I want to know about kidney and liver function, heart disease, pregnancy, clotting disorders, G6PD status if considering high dose vitamin C IV, and current medications. People with heart failure may not tolerate large fluid volumes. Those with chronic kidney disease need careful dosing and, often, oral options instead. If you are on diuretics, ACE inhibitors, or lithium, electrolytes deserve extra attention. If you live with anxiety, the IV experience itself can trigger symptoms, so a quiet room and paced breathing help.
Mobile IV therapy and at home IV therapy have grown rapidly. Convenience is appealing, yet the standard should not drop just because the setting is a living room. A qualified clinician should insert the line, monitor vitals, and carry emergency medications. When clients ask for concierge IV therapy, I ask about the provider’s credentials, supply chain for sterile fluids and tubing, and protocols for adverse events. On demand IV therapy is still medical care.
Costs and expectations
IV therapy cost varies by region and contents. In most metro clinics in North America, a simple hydration drip runs 100 to 200 dollars. Additive-heavy vitamin drip therapy with glutathione and high dose vitamin C IV can climb to 250 to 400 dollars per session, sometimes more. IV therapy packages lower per-session pricing but can nudge people into overuse. I prefer setting a trial period: two to three IV therapy sessions over six to eight weeks, then reassess. If the results justify the spend and you have no side effects, a maintenance cadence of monthly or as-needed sessions can make sense.
Do not assume that higher price equals higher quality. You are paying for time, ingredients, and facility overhead. A clean, well-run IV therapy clinic with transparent formulas can be more valuable than a spa that promises miracles.
How detox-focused IV formulas map to common goals
Clients rarely walk in asking for “phase 2 hepatic conjugation support.” They come in because they feel foggy, puffy, depleted, or off their baseline. Matching goals to formulas brings clarity.
For fatigue IV therapy, the combination of fluids, B complex IV therapy, and magnesium can help those who are under-rested or post-viral. The boost often lasts 24 to 72 hours. If you need a more pronounced iv energy boost, some clinics add carnitine or amino acids, though evidence is modest. For immune boost IV therapy, lower-dose vitamin C with zinc and hydration makes sense at the first sign of a cold if your stomach cannot handle oral supplements. Immunity IV therapy should not replace sleep, nasal hygiene, or vaccines.
For skin glow IV therapy in a beauty IV therapy context, hydration plus vitamin C and glutathione IV therapy sometimes yields a brighter look for a few days, partly from improved vascular filling and partly from antioxidant effects. For weight loss IV therapy or metabolism IV therapy, keep your expectations tight. There is no intravenous shortcut to fat loss. A hydration drip can help you feel better during the first week of a caloric change or after a hard training block, but body composition shifts come from sustained nutrition and activity.
Stress relief IV therapy and anxiety IV therapy drift into subjective territory. Some people feel calmer after fluids and magnesium. Others feel jittery from the clinical environment. If stress drives your symptoms, sleep support IV therapy that emphasizes magnesium and gentle hydration, with a quiet setting and slow infusion, may be more helpful than a stimulant-heavy formula.
Brain boost IV therapy, focus IV therapy, and memory IV therapy claims are trendy. Hydration can improve daytime alertness by a small but real margin. Beyond that, no IV guarantees cognitive enhancement. If you are chasing productivity, combine any session with a plan for structured breaks and hydration the next day.

What a responsible detox IV session typically looks like
A well-run session starts with a short intake: vitals, history, allergies, goals for the day. The clinician reviews the plan for a customized IV therapy, explains the ingredients, and confirms consent. A peripheral IV is placed using sterile technique. The drip runs 30 to 60 minutes, sometimes longer if the bag includes magnesium or other agents that can cause flushing when infused rapidly. You should feel no more than a cool sensation and a gradual sense of ease as hydration rises. If you feel lightheaded, tingly, or short of breath, the infusion should stop and vitals should be reassessed. Afterward, keep drinking water, eat a balanced meal with protein and potassium-rich foods, and avoid heavy alcohol that day.
Patients often ask how quickly they will notice a difference. Hydration and relief from nausea or headache can shift within 30 to 90 minutes. Energy changes are more variable, appearing over a few hours. Sleep that night is commonly deeper. Special cases and edge scenarios
People with post-viral fatigue sometimes respond to gentle wellness drip protocols that prioritize hydration, low-dose vitamins, and magnesium, avoiding anything overly stimulating. POTS or orthostatic intolerance patients occasionally benefit from saline IV therapy, but this should be coordinated with a cardiologist or autonomic specialist; frequent saline can help symptoms while potentially affecting electrolyte balance. Competitive athletes may use iv recovery therapy after events, but governing bodies in some sports have rules about large-volume infusions outside hospital settings. If you compete at a high level, check your rulebook before scheduling sports IV therapy.
For migraineurs, a clinic experienced in IV migraine treatment matters. The right mix can abort an attack and reduce the need for emergency care. For those with chronic skin conditions aggravated by dehydration, periodic hydration drip sessions paired with topical regimens can reduce flares. Again, the IV does not treat the skin disease directly; it supports one of the triggers you can influence.
The bottom line on myths and facts
Detox IV therapy is not a magic pipe-cleaning service for your bloodstream. It is a way to deliver fluids, electrolytes, and nutrients that can support the body systems responsible for detoxification and recovery. The facts that stand up: IV hydration works quickly, IV vitamins bypass a finicky gut, magnesium helps some migraines, and glutathione is a legitimate cellular antioxidant. The myths to discard: that any IV drip therapy can directly remove toxins, that it replaces sleep and nutrition, or that more ingredients automatically mean better outcomes.
Used judiciously, IV therapy benefits the right person at the right time. It can smooth the rough edges after a stomach bug, shorten the misery of a hangover, or provide a bridge during heavy travel. It can give an athlete a safe assist between back-to-back efforts, and it can be tailored for those recovering from illness who cannot tolerate oral intake. Its value drops when it is sold as a weekly cleanse, when screening is sloppy, or when expectations outrun physiology.
If you are considering immune support IV therapy before cold season, a metabolism IV therapy during a training block, or a detox drip after a stretch of stress, anchor the decision in your specific needs, your medical background, and the competence of the provider. Your liver and kidneys are already doing the heavy lifting. Give them the conditions to thrive: sleep, steady nutrition, movement, hydration, and, when the situation calls for it, a thoughtful, well-run IV.
